Bild kan vara representation.
Se specifikationer för produktinformation.
XC7Z020-2CLG400CES

XC7Z020-2CLG400CES

Product Overview

Category

The XC7Z020-2CLG400CES belongs to the category of programmable System-on-Chip (SoC) devices.

Use

This product is commonly used in various electronic applications that require high-performance processing and programmable logic capabilities.

Characteristics

  • Programmable SoC with integrated processing system and programmable logic
  • High-performance processing capabilities
  • Flexible and customizable design options
  • Suitable for a wide range of applications

Package

The XC7Z020-2CLG400CES is available in a CLG400 package, which refers to a 400-ball chip-scale grid array package.

Essence

The essence of this product lies in its ability to combine a processing system and programmable logic into a single device, providing a versatile solution for complex electronic designs.

Packaging/Quantity

The XC7Z020-2CLG400CES is typically packaged individually and is available in various quantities depending on the specific requirements of the customer or application.

Specifications

  • Device Type: Programmable System-on-Chip (SoC)
  • Model Number: XC7Z020-2CLG400CES
  • Package Type: CLG400
  • Operating Temperature Range: -40°C to +100°C
  • Supply Voltage: 1.0V to 3.3V
  • Maximum Logic Cells: 85,000
  • Maximum DSP Slices: 220
  • Maximum Block RAM: 4,860 Kb
  • Maximum External Memory Interfaces: 2
  • Maximum I/O Pins: 200

Detailed Pin Configuration

The XC7Z020-2CLG400CES has a total of 400 pins arranged in a grid array configuration. The pinout diagram provides detailed information about the function and connectivity of each pin.

Functional Features

  • Dual-core ARM Cortex-A9 processor
  • Programmable logic fabric with configurable logic blocks (CLBs)
  • High-speed interfaces such as Gigabit Ethernet, USB, and PCIe
  • Integrated memory controllers for DDR3/DDR4 SDRAM
  • On-chip analog-to-digital converters (ADCs) and digital-to-analog converters (DACs)

Advantages and Disadvantages

Advantages

  • Versatile and flexible design options
  • High-performance processing capabilities
  • Integration of processing system and programmable logic
  • Wide range of available peripherals and interfaces

Disadvantages

  • Complex programming and configuration process
  • Higher cost compared to traditional microcontrollers or processors
  • Steeper learning curve for inexperienced users

Working Principles

The XC7Z020-2CLG400CES combines the processing power of dual-core ARM Cortex-A9 processors with the flexibility of programmable logic. The processors handle general-purpose computing tasks, while the programmable logic allows for custom hardware acceleration and interface control.

Detailed Application Field Plans

The XC7Z020-2CLG400CES is suitable for a wide range of applications, including but not limited to: - Embedded systems - Industrial automation - Robotics - Automotive electronics - Aerospace and defense - High-performance computing - Medical devices

Alternative Models

  • XC7Z010-1CLG400C
  • XC7Z030-1SBG485I
  • XC7Z045-2FFG900I
  • XC7Z100-2FFG900C

These alternative models offer similar functionality and performance but may have different package types or pin configurations.

In conclusion, the XC7Z020-2CLG400CES is a versatile programmable SoC device that combines high-performance processing capabilities with programmable logic. Its integration of a processing system and programmable logic makes it suitable for a wide range of applications in various industries. While it offers advantages such as flexibility and performance, it also has some disadvantages, including complexity and higher cost. Nonetheless, its working principles and detailed application field plans make it a valuable choice for many electronic designs.

Lista 10 Vanliga frågor och svar relaterade till tillämpningen av XC7Z020-2CLG400CES i tekniska lösningar

Sure! Here are 10 common questions and answers related to the application of XC7Z020-2CLG400CES in technical solutions:

  1. Q: What is XC7Z020-2CLG400CES? A: XC7Z020-2CLG400CES is a System-on-Chip (SoC) device from Xilinx, specifically from the Zynq-7000 family. It combines an ARM Cortex-A9 processor with programmable logic, making it suitable for a wide range of applications.

  2. Q: What are the key features of XC7Z020-2CLG400CES? A: The key features include a dual-core ARM Cortex-A9 processor, programmable logic fabric, on-chip memory, various I/O interfaces, and support for multiple communication protocols.

  3. Q: What are some typical applications of XC7Z020-2CLG400CES? A: XC7Z020-2CLG400CES can be used in applications such as industrial automation, embedded systems, robotics, automotive electronics, medical devices, and high-performance computing.

  4. Q: How much programmable logic is available in XC7Z020-2CLG400CES? A: XC7Z020-2CLG400CES offers 85,000 logic cells, which can be used for implementing custom digital circuits or accelerating specific algorithms.

  5. Q: What operating systems are supported by XC7Z020-2CLG400CES? A: XC7Z020-2CLG400CES supports various operating systems, including Linux, FreeRTOS, and other real-time operating systems (RTOS).

  6. Q: Can XC7Z020-2CLG400CES interface with external devices? A: Yes, XC7Z020-2CLG400CES provides a wide range of interfaces, such as UART, SPI, I2C, Ethernet, USB, PCIe, and more, allowing it to communicate with external devices.

  7. Q: How can I program XC7Z020-2CLG400CES? A: XC7Z020-2CLG400CES can be programmed using Xilinx's Vivado Design Suite, which provides a graphical interface for designing and implementing the programmable logic portion of the device.

  8. Q: Can XC7Z020-2CLG400CES support real-time processing requirements? A: Yes, XC7Z020-2CLG400CES has a dual-core ARM Cortex-A9 processor that can handle real-time processing tasks, making it suitable for applications with strict timing requirements.

  9. Q: Is XC7Z020-2CLG400CES suitable for low-power applications? A: XC7Z020-2CLG400CES offers power management features, allowing it to operate in low-power modes when idle or under light load conditions, making it suitable for low-power applications.

  10. Q: Are there any development boards available for XC7Z020-2CLG400CES? A: Yes, Xilinx provides development boards like the ZedBoard and Zybo, which feature XC7Z020-2CLG400CES, along with various peripherals and connectors for easy prototyping and development.

Please note that these answers are general and may vary depending on specific implementation details and requirements.